The Town of Port Hedland uses an online quotation tool called eQuotes (Vendorpanel) to simplify the way the Town seeks quotations and tenders from potential suppliers. eQuotes is used by hundreds of organisations across Australia to increase transparency and compliance in quote-based purchasing.  

One part of eQuotes is an online directory of suppliers called Vendorpanel Marketplace.  To have your business included on Vendorpanel Marketplace, all you need to do is sign up (it’s free) and create a profile.  When projects come up that fit with your business category you will be presented to relevant council staff as a supplier option.

If we request a quote from you you’ll be notified via email and can easily review the quotation request and submit your quote securely through your Vendorpanel Marketplace profile – just follow the prompts.

Rest assured your submitted quote will only be visible to relevant Council staff making this a no-risk and simple way of accessing more business opportunities.
